11538905
0x8e70d86c56aae7c8f1d25a7e4d22ee2e2b1edc3563317b8ec5dc3c3f496e4829
Transactions165
Height11538905
Confirmations7887558
Timestamp1265 days 11 hours ago
Size (bytes)47431
Version
Merkle Root
Nonce0xbb46e14c5c00a8a6
Bits
Difficulty0xd1055e043e479

Transactions

mined 1265 days 11 hours ago
Failed
0xdfbe4a31
ERC20 Token Transfers